Mr. Hebert Lee Frink 87, of Chadbourn passed on Friday, March 17, 2023, at his residence surrounded by his loving family. He was the son of the late Deacon Maurice Archie Frink and Mrs. Hettie Hardee Frink of Columbus County.

Mr. Frink was preceded in death by his oldest grandson: Herbert Marsail Quinn and siblings: Willie Frink, Robert Frink, Curtis Frink, Bradie Frink, Perry Frink, Lucille Frink, Mary Frink, and Minnie Frink.
Funeral services will be conducted on Wednesday, March 22, 2023, at 12:00 noon from St. John Missionary Baptist Church, 888 Tommie Wooten Road, Chadbourn, with pastor Rev. Darryl Hardy. Mr. Frink's children will deliver the eulogy. Burial will follow in the Belvue Cemetery, 1055 Clarendon Chadbourn Road.
Mr. Frink is survived by his wife of 65 years: Mrs. Helen Green Frink; five children: Eldress Van G. LeSane, Mrs. Deloris Frink Chavis, Pastor Lester Frink, Sr., (Marsha C. Frink), Evangelist Betty F. Sturdivant (Rev. Eugene Sturdivant) all of Chadbourn; Mrs. Velvet Frink Watson (Bill Watson) of Greensboro; two sisters: Mrs. Ethel Kimble of Philadelphia, Pa., and Ms. Donna Frink of Chadbourn; 13 grandchildren, 14 great grandchildren, one sister-in-law: Mrs. Lucy Frink, one brother-in-law: Mr. Robert Williams, Sr., and a host of relatives and friends.
Viewing will be held on Tuesday, March 22, 2023, from 4 p.m. to 6 p.m. in the Smith Funeral Home Chapel, and again on Wednesday one hour prior to the services.
